Reading one of the best online publications for business owners out there, I came across what’s called a “social media tool kit” page on INC magazine which I thought, WOW, this one URL has so many GOOD resources for e-commerce business owners starting out and just gives a great direction and guide into things that these days are just essential 2.0 elements of a website.


If you run an e-commerce business and think many of the young demographic isn’t judging your website on certain factors such as a Twitter page, Facebook page, etc, you’re DEAD WRONG. As the new generation comes up already used to these sites and a part of their lives and the web, they look for these elements on websites to engage.

The four essential elements in the social scope you must have are:

1- BLOG

2- SOCIAL NETWORKING

3- MULTI-MEDIA TOOLS

4- ONLINE REVIEWS AND OPINIONS
